Output 8c7a3d7453b3af381335ddbe551b959ec4d71ea2b1aaa2b00ba2c64b71340620:0

value
2348650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5727b799dabd3936d0d0ad8af9c7e329091eb658 OP_EQUAL
address
39drHqCYxdHjbpebZ4DEfNbd21FLS9esrj
transaction
8c7a3d7453b3af381335ddbe551b959ec4d71ea2b1aaa2b00ba2c64b71340620
spent
true